Andean meaning
Andean is an adjective that refers to the Andes mountain range, which is the longest mountain range in the world, stretching over 7,000 kilometers along the western coast of South America. The Andean region is known for its diverse geography, rich culture, and unique flora and fauna. If you want to use the word Andean in a sentence, here are some tips to help you do so correctly.
1. Understand the meaning of Andean Before using the word Andean in a sentence, it is important to understand its meaning. Andean refers to anything related to the Andes mountain range or the Andean region, which includes parts of Colombia, Ecuador, Peru, Bolivia, Chile, and Argentina. This can include the people, culture, geography, or wildlife of the region.
2. Use Andean as an adjective Andean is an adjective, which means it is used to describe a noun. When using Andean in a sentence, it should be placed before the noun it is describing.
For example, "The Andean condor is a large bird found in the Andes mountains" or "The Andean culture is known for its vibrant textiles and intricate weaving techniques."
3. Use Andean in context When using Andean in a sentence, it is important to use it in context. This means that the sentence should provide enough information for the reader to understand what you are referring to.
For example, "The Andean region is home to many indigenous communities" provides context for the use of Andean, as it specifies that the region being referred to is the Andes.
4. Be specific When using Andean in a sentence, it is important to be specific about what you are referring to.
For example, instead of saying "I love Andean food," you could say "I love the spicy and flavorful dishes of Andean cuisine, such as ceviche and aj de gallina."
5. Use Andean in a geographical context Andean is often used in a geographical context, as it refers to the Andes mountain range and the surrounding region. When using Andean in this context, it is important to be specific about the location.
For example, "The Andean peaks of Peru are some of the highest in the world" or "The Andean foothills of Colombia are home to many coffee plantations."
In conclusion, Andean is a versatile adjective that can be used to describe anything related to the Andes mountain range or the Andean region. When using Andean in a sentence, it is important to understand its meaning, use it as an adjective, provide context, be specific, and use it in a geographical context. By following these tips, you can use Andean correctly and effectively in your writing.
